Putin's phone call with Scholz was not easy but 'absolutely businesslike' - Peskov

MOSCOW. March 18 (Interfax) - It is the Russian people rather than the German chancellor who should decide "whom Russia should be with," Russian presidential press secretary Dmitry Peskov said.

"After all, perhaps it's for the Russian people, not for the German chancellor, to decide whom Russia should be with," Peskov told journalists on Friday, commenting on German Chancellor Olaf Scholz's remark that Russia should not be equated with President Vladimir Putin.

The Russian and German leaders had "quite a difficult, but absolutely businesslike conversation" over the telephone on Friday.

"The conversation can hardly be described as a friendly one. It was certainly a tough conversation. Nevertheless, there is a need for such contacts, an exchange of information, and a discussion of urgent subjects related to the special operation," Peskov said.
